This route is perfectly calibrated for an 8-day journey. Covering 815 km over this timeframe allows for short daily drives (averaging just over 100 km per day), giving you plenty of time to explore amusement parks, hike, and enjoy long traditional meals without feeling rushed.
Absolutely. If you are looking for a trip that balances the tranquility of nature with the excitement of family activities, this eastern loop from Dusseldorf is ideal. It packs heritage, extreme activities, and wildlife into a highly accessible, easy-to-navigate region of Germany.
This itinerary is tailor-made for families with children, nature enthusiasts, and travelers who appreciate a mix of history and outdoor recreation. The abundance of water parks, animal shows, and interactive museums ensures younger travelers stay engaged.
Late spring through early autumn offers the best weather for this route. Summer is ideal for water parks and amusement parks, while the shoulder seasons (May, September) provide beautiful hiking conditions and smaller crowds at heritage sites.
Because this is a roundtrip starting and ending in Dusseldorf, you immediately bypass one-way rental fees, making it a highly cost-effective choice. The modest total distance of 815 km means that standard mileage packages included in most European RV rentals will likely cover your entire journey without incurring extra per-kilometer charges.
When budgeting, consider a mid-sized motorhome or a larger Class C if traveling with a family, ensuring you have enough space to relax after long days of hiking and amusement park visits. Your primary costs will be campground fees—which vary between basic nature sites and fully-equipped holiday parks—and entrance fees for the various extreme activities and wildlife parks along the way.
